Although a reference assembly from Illumina reads is available for D. pulex (Ye, et al. 2017), it is still fragmented and contains ~13 million gaps. Moreover, due to the conserved strategy of predicting genes with at least two pieces of evidence, key genes may have been missed in the reference genome. To solve this, we generated an improved assembly of sexual D. pulex using reads from 20 PacBio SMRT cells, with total coverage of 79.4x. The reads were assembled by Canu (Koren, et al. 2017) and further scaffolded with dovetail reads. The draft genome presented here, PA42 4.1, consists of 190 Mb of sequences located on 493 scaffolds. The N50 scaffold size is 1.2 Mb, which increased by 134% compared to the previous assembly. The N50 scaffold number is 36 and the largest scaffold is 7.6 Mb, indicating high integrity of the assembly. Mean scaffold size is 4.5 times and median scaffold size is 17.7 times of the previous assembly. In addition, the genome size has increased by 33.1 Mb and gap size has decreased by 9.4 Mb, which is likely due to repetitive regions in the genome were resolved by the long reads.
